Abstract::
      Objective To investigate the influence of low-dose ionizing radiation on the expression level of serum insulin-like growth factor binding protein-3 (IGFBP-3) in radiation workers in hospitals. Methods 183 radiation workers were randomly selected and grouped by work type including interventional radiology (n=37), nuclear medicine (n=43), radiotherapy (n=48), and diagnostic radiology (n=55). The content of IGFBP-3 in the serum of radiation workers was detected by ELISA assay. Results It was observed that the expression level of serum IGFBP-3 in the four groups had significant differences (F=6.056, P<0.05), and the content of serum IGFBP-3 in the interventional radiology group was significantly higher than that of nuclear medicine, radiotherapy, and diagnostic radiology groups (t= 2.815, 3.611, 3.936, P<0.05). The concentration of IGFBP-3 in the serum of radiation workers among different annual effective dose groups was statistically different (F=8.380, P<0.05), which gradually increased with the increase of annual effective dose and length of service (rs=0.202, 0.151,P<0.05). Conclusions The expression level of serum IGFBP-3 has the potential to be used as a biomarker to reflect the cumulative exposure of long-term chronic low-dose ionizing radiation.
